Assembly requires state agencies to adopt telework policies; members debate impacts on performance and Albany economy

Summary

A bill requiring each state agency to establish a telework policy or program passed the Assembly. Sponsors say the change helps recruitment; critics warned about service quality, local economic effects and administrative costs. The measure takes effect on the 90th day and passed 126–18.

The Assembly passed legislation directing each state agency to establish a policy or program allowing employees to perform all or part of their duties through telework "to the maximum extent possible without a decline in employee performance."
